Output 3d80be0366393ddde84695ff16aeccddbf753d909c38e503b070b5eca6a41312:0

value
5311274
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91d8bbd42eec99ef6eec29d59f23d7d1a3157f13 OP_EQUALVERIFY OP_CHECKSIG
address
1EJAcjmPVPC4zJe9ETf69wRDYdGLP4xmj7
transaction
3d80be0366393ddde84695ff16aeccddbf753d909c38e503b070b5eca6a41312
spent
true